Sleepy Posted June 13, 2014 Report Share Posted June 13, 2014 This card had to be banned because come on! Did you see what the format was like when it happened? Dragon Rulers were like 30/10 ratio in favor of monsters, and Spellbooks were equally extreme in favor of maining Spells. Even after that format ended, there's a constant in Yugioh: Decks will often have a style that favors them using a certain kind of card at all times, and their outs often need those same ones to work out of a tight spot. Unbaning Shock Master at any point will force them back into more equal ratios of card kinds in the main deck when thinking about making archetypes that do not immediately lose in a Shock Master scenario. Which I do believe Konami is capable of eventually creating that kind of environment, much more in the near future since they are focusing on carrying over all past mechanics of the game. Though, as of now, definitely Shock Master is unfair and stupid. It takes calling the right thing against the right decks to seal your opponent until you are ahead enough to guarantee you are gonna win. Even if limited, that just makes Number 69 have a reason to be used as a second copy, which is not as hard to do as it looks, and makes me pretty much scratch the possibility of Shock Master ever coming back even if all decks in the game had a balanced ratio of Spell/Trap/Monster Cards..... Now I am starting to think that Shock Master should have been a 4 material that needs 3 detached cards to work.....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
